Humorously Yours Season 2 is a Hindi web series created by TVF Play. The plot revolves around gaps that were left in the previous season. The funny events take a different turn and gives us an amazing experience.

The Major cast of Humorously Yours Season 2 Web Series includes Sahil Verma, Vipul Goyal, Rasika Dugal in the lead.

The Price of Laughter: Inside the World of ‘Humorously Yours Season 2’
The journey of a stand-up comedian is often perceived as a glamorous ascent from open-mic nights to sold-out stadiums. But what happens once the spotlight is permanently fixed, and the jokes become a full-fledged business? That is the core question explored in ‘Humorously Yours Season 2,’ the 2019 follow-up to The Viral Fever’s (TVF) semi-autobiographical series starring comedian Vipul Goyal.
While the first season meticulously chronicled the gritty, everyday struggle of an aspiring comedian trying to secure his big break, the second season pivots to the ‘after’—the complex, often funny, and sometimes chaotic life of a successful artist who is now a brand. Released on June 7, 2019, the four-episode web series, directed by Deepak Kumar Mishra, offered a nuanced and, at times, self-deprecating look at how fame can change the man behind the mic and the dynamics of his closest relationships.
Quick Facts: ‘Humorously Yours Season 2’
| Category | Detail |
|---|---|
| Release Date | June 7, 2019 |
| Platform | TVF Play and MX Player (Also available on ZEE5) |
| Creator | Amit Golani |
| Director | Deepak Kumar Mishra |
| Writers | Vipul Goyal, Anant Singh, Chandan Kumar |
| Genre | Comedy, Drama, Reality-Fiction |
| No. of Episodes | 4 |
From Struggler to Star: The Season 2 Premise
The first season introduced audiences to Vipul Goyal, an engineer-turned-comedian navigating the harsh realities of the stand-up circuit, which included financial woes, family doubts, and the constant battle for stage time. His biggest challenge, however, was his inability to manage the business side of his career, which led him to create a fictitious, gruff-voiced manager named Ranjit Walia—his own double life.
Season 2 kicks off precisely where the first one left off: with success. Vipul is now a well-known name, enjoying houseful shows and the perks of celebrity status, but his problems haven’t disappeared—they’ve simply evolved. The new season delves deep into the increased workload and professional pressures that accompany fame.
The Core Conflicts
The four episodes of ‘Humorously Yours Season 2’ explore three major, interconnected themes that challenge the protagonist:
1. The Demise of Ranjit Walia
The opening of the season addresses Vipul’s exhausting double life as both the comedian and his own fictional, intimidating manager, Ranjit Walia. The charade of having an alter-ego for clients becomes increasingly difficult to sustain as his career explodes. The first episode, “Long Live Ranjit Walia,” sees Vipul finally decide to put the imaginary manager to rest and hire a real one. This transition forms a key professional plotline, introducing Punit Lamba (played by Sahil Verma), a younger, ambitious, and slightly arrogant college junior, as his new, actual manager. The dynamic between the grounded Vipul and the business-savvy Lamba provides much of the professional comedy and tension of the series.
2. The Business of Stand-up Comedy
Moving past the struggle for survival, the series gives a rare, deep insight into the business of stand-up comedy in India. It showcases the mechanics of ticket sales, managing large-scale gigs in non-metro cities like Lucknow (as seen in the episode “The Weekend”), dealing with invoices, client demands, and the pressures of “going big.” Vipul has to contend with the stress of justifying his celebrity status and the fear of his popularity plateauing, which is a new form of anxiety compared to the struggle of obscurity.
3. Personal Life Under the Spotlight
Arguably the most crucial element of Season 2 is the strain fame puts on Vipul’s personal relationship with his wife, Kavya (played by the effortless Rasika Dugal). The couple, who were bickering over mundane domestic chores in Season 1, now face the much trickier issue of celebrity baggage. Kavya has to deal with the inevitable increase in female fan attention her husband receives, leading to moments of jealousy and misunderstanding. The season explores how fame requires a certain maturity from both partners to navigate the spotlight and temptations that come with building a ‘brand.’
The Cast and Characters
The success of Humorously Yours lies significantly in the authenticity and chemistry of its core cast.
The Protagonist
- Vipul Goyal as Himself: The series maintains its semi-autobiographical tone, with Vipul playing a version of himself. In Season 2, he sheds the identity of the struggling comic to portray a more mature, but still flawed, celebrity dealing with a new set of problems. His earnestness and sincerity toward his craft remain the heart and soul of the show.
The Anchors
- Rasika Dugal as Kavya: Rasika Dugal is a key pillar of the series, playing Vipul’s grounded and supportive yet increasingly exasperated wife, Kavya. Her performance, particularly in the scenes that depict the bittersweet reality of a comedian’s wife, where she is happy for his success but miffed by the increasing intrusions into their personal space, is widely praised.
- Abhishek Banerjee as Bhushi: Vipul’s best friend, accountant, and travel companion, Bhushi (or ‘Bhusa’), remains a constant source of comic relief and a sounding board for Vipul’s anxieties.
The New Addition
- Sahil Verma as Punit Lamba: Lamba is the antithesis of the fictitious Ranjit Walia. He is a real, professional manager—Vipul’s college junior—who is tasked with taking Vipul’s career to the next level. His presence represents the professionalisation of Vipul’s career and introduces new, relatable ‘workplace’ conflicts.
Noteworthy Cameos
A signature of the TVF series is the inclusion of well-known faces and comedians in cameo roles, lending an authentic feel to the comedy world depicted.
- Jitendra Kumar (Jeetu Bhaiya): The popular TVF actor makes a memorable appearance as Mastikhor Mishra, an RJ at a Lucknow radio station, stealing the show in his short screen time.
- Anupriya Goenka: She plays Devika, Vipul’s former college crush and an ardent fan, who re-enters his life and creates complications, particularly with Kavya.
- Tanmay Bhat: The comedian also features in a brief cameo, further rooting the show in the real Indian stand-up comedy circuit.
Critical Reception and Audience Connect
The reception for Humorously Yours Season 2 was somewhat mixed compared to the highly acclaimed first season.
What Worked for Critics
- The Business Insight: Many reviewers appreciated the show for being one of the first of its kind to offer an honest glimpse into the financial and logistical workings of the stand-up comedy business, moving beyond the simple ‘struggle narrative.’
- Strong Performances: The acting, especially the chemistry between Vipul Goyal and Rasika Dugal, was consistently highlighted as a strong point. Dugal’s portrayal of a wife navigating her husband’s newfound fame was noted as effortless and commanding. Abhishek Banerjee and Sahil Verma were also praised for their entertaining supporting roles.
- Authenticity and Relatability: The series retained its grounded, realistic feel, presenting Vipul as a “flawed celebrity” whose problems, though unique to his profession, are fundamentally relatable to anyone juggling a demanding career with personal life.
Areas of Criticism
- Lack of Narrative Focus: Some critics felt the season was “scattered” and “unnecessary,” arguing that the makers failed to fully explore the world of stand-up and instead focused too heavily on personal drama that felt manufactured at times.
- Pacing and Underuse of Talent: The four-episode structure was sometimes seen as limiting, with the plot feeling like “much ado about nothing” in the middle episodes. Furthermore, critics felt actors like Abhishek Banerjee (Bhushi) and Rasika Dugal were underutilised, with Dugal’s character being given less dynamic material compared to the first season.
Despite the slightly lukewarm critical reception, the season was considered a worthwhile watch for die-hard fans of the first installment and those curious about the pressures of success. The final episode, Back to College, which brought the season to a close, was often cited as the most emotionally satisfying part of the arc.
Legacy and Impact on Indian Web Content
‘Humorously Yours’ has cemented its place in the early pantheon of successful Indian web series, particularly those emerging from The Viral Fever (TVF), known for its slice-of-life and relatable content. While Season 1 was an anthem for the dreamer, Season 2 became a cautionary tale about the reality of the dream achieved.
The series successfully transitioned from a story about a man who wants to be famous to a story about a man who has to manage his fame, thereby addressing a less-explored theme in Indian narratives. By depicting Vipul’s journey—from creating a fake manager (Ranjit Walia) to navigating the complex landscape of PR disasters and fan attention—the series offers a compelling and amusing commentary on the difference between being a good artist and being a successful celebrity brand. The show, through its blend of comedy and drama, provides a mirror to the modern, competitive, and highly scrutinised world of a public figure.
